A m e n d m e n t s t o S u p p l e m e n t a r y R u l e s f o r A d m in i s t r a t i o n o f G r a z in g D i s t r ic t s
To All Officers, Division of Grazing:
S i r s : In addition to the remedies provided fo r the enforce ment of, and redress fo r violation of, the Rules fo r Adminis tration of Grazing Districts approved by the Secretary of the Interior on March 2,1936, as amended by Supplementary Rules approved July 14, 1936, the follow ing action w ill be taken in appropriate cases:
DISCIPLINARY ACTION BY REGIONAL GRAZIERS
The regional grazier is hereby granted authority to revoke a grazing license, in whole or in part, fo r a clearly established trespass or violation of the terms or conditions of the license or of the regulations upon which it is based, or the instruc tions of the officers o f the Division of Grazing issued there under; provided, however, that before any license is revoked, in whole or in part,- the regional grazier, or his authorized representative, shall serve, or cause to be served, a notice upon such licensee, setting forth the trespass or violation with which he is charged and citing him to appear before the regional grazier, or his authorized representative, at a tim e and place named in the notice w ithin forty-eigh t hours and show cause why his license should not be revoked in whole or in part.
I f upon the hearing of the order to show cause the tres pass or violation with which the licensee is charged has been established, the regional grazier shall revoke the license in whole or in part as he may deem proper.
Failure of the person served in the notice to appear at the time and place designated in the notice, or the absence o f a good and sufficient showing as to why he failed to appear, shall be considered an admission o f guilt of the trespass or other violation charged in the notice and w ill be sufficient reason fo r revocation o f the license.
AMICABLE SETTLEMENT OF CIVIL TRESPASS CASES
The peaceful, voluntary settlem ent, fo r damages resulting from trespass or violation o f the tenps or conditions of a license, or of the rules, regulations, or orders provided fo r the administration of grazing districts is to be preferred to a lawsuit in most cases. Therefore, in cases where a voluntary settlement fo r such damages may be procured, and in the judgment of the regional grazier the offer constitutes fa ir restitution to the Government fo r the damage, he shall sub mit the same w ith appropriate recommendation fo r the consideration of the Department.

ISSUANCE OR RENEWAL OF LICENSE
In cases where a trespasser or violator of the rules desires a grazing license or a renewal thereof, settlement of the dam ages resulting from the trespass or violation shall be required before favorable action is taken on the application.
Nothing herein provided is intended to deny the right of appeal from actions of the regional grazier as provided by the Rules fo r Adm inistration of Grazing Districts, but pending ap peal and determination thereof, the decision of the regional grazier shall be in fu ll force and effect.
